Output d5688e4ff56cb3986016eb93b77012220eb3fb86fe5f333ec0b38963c0321212:0

value
654682953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c59c15b4153485001ec7e1eb63a98abb236dc353 OP_EQUALVERIFY OP_CHECKSIG
address
1K1s6kZw85vDMpmC4W1aYkSRa9hdVCRrZQ
transaction
d5688e4ff56cb3986016eb93b77012220eb3fb86fe5f333ec0b38963c0321212
spent
true